What is the best time of year to rent a RIB in Antibes, France?

When planning a RIB rental in Antibes, France, it’s important to consider the best time of year for sailing. The high season is between June - August and provides the warmest weather and the most vibrant atmosphere. The average water temperature during this period is 24–28°C, making it ideal for swimming, snorkeling, and other water activities. If you prefer a more peaceful experience, the months in May and September offer great conditions with fewer tourists. During this time, you can still enjoy great boating weather while avoiding the peak season crowds. Whatever the time of year, Antibes, France is a perfect place for an unforgettable RIB trip.
